Community Care
We love the community where we do business, and our desire is to give back a portion of what we’ve been blessed with. In 2020, we entered a partnership with the organization OneGenAway, which addresses food insecurity by bringing mobile food pantries to host communities. Kudzu Millwork sponsored the first OneGenAway food distribution in Fort Payne in May 2021 with plans to host at least two food distributions a year.
Global Care
In 2019, we expanded our reach to include global missions by partnering with Mission Firefly to adopt a village in Guatemala. Mission Firefly is a local organization that connects villages in Guatemala with businesses and organizations that can help supply clean water, clothing, shelter, education and more.
Through Mission Firefly, Kudzu Millwork can send teams of employees to the small village of El Potrerillo, Guatemala, to assist with construction projects, medical clinics and youth activities. Recent projects include the construction of a well and water filtration system to provide clean water to the approximately 60 families who call El Potrerillo home.
